Geraldton Primary School
Geraldton 6530 · K-6
Geraldton Primary School is a Government primary school in Geraldton, WA offering K-6. With an ICSEA score of 990 — placing it in the 42th percentile nationally, near average the Australian average of 1,000. The school has 397 enrolled students with approximately 14 students per teacher. 12% of students identify as Aboriginal or Torres Strait Islander, and and 21% have a language background other than English.
ICSEA Context
ICSEA (Index of Community Socio-Educational Advantage) measures the socio-educational background of a school's student community. The Australian average is 1,000. Geraldton Primary School scores 990 — near average.
